QA Automation: що за професія? Обов’язки Шляхи кар’єрного зростання

професія QA Automation Engineer

Сьогодні є багато ресурсів та курсів, інформації з яких достатньо для опанування сфери тестування. Відмінність тестувальника і QA Engineer в тому, що перший тільки визначає наявність і вид неполадок, а завданням другого є їх профілактика на етапі розробки програми. Отримавши додаткову освіту, Тестувальник може перекваліфікуватися в QA Engineer, однак для цього необхідно вивчити масу додаткової інформації.

Перспективы развития профессии QA automation

професія QA Automation Engineer

QA Automation engineer – це фахівець із забезпечення якості продукту, який використовує програмні засоби для створення тестів і перевірки результатів виконання. QA Automation Engineer Ілля Студіград допоможе зорієнтуватись в професії інженера з автоматизації тестування. QA Automation – професія на стику тестування та програмування, яка є дуже перспективним напрямком як для початківців, так і для досвідчених технічних фахівців. «Важливо розуміти, що Senior — це не про кількість технічних знань і вмінь, а про відповідальність.

  • Завдання оцінює вся команда, зокрема й тестувальники.
  • QA важливо врахувати свою зайнятість, чи встигне він закінчити заплановану роботу.
  • Найбільш поширений недолік полягає в тому, що на деяких проектах робота зводиться до одноманітного запуску тестів без розробки нових.
  • Але це приблизний період, усе залежить від відточування навичок і наполегливості.
  • Зазвичай цим займаються тестувальники-автоматизатори.
  • І коли QA вперше на мітингу, йому складно відразу оцінити всю роботу.

Подготовка к профессии QA Automation Engineer

Хоча в мене жодного разу  на інтерв’ю не питали про те, які курси я закінчила за спеціальністю чи які сертифікати маю. QA automation engineer — це фахівець, який займається забезпеченням якості продукту відповідно до стандартів і специфікацій. Мінус автоматизаторів — це складніший напрям для вивчення.

Хто такий QA automation engineer та як ним стати

  • Проте є й ширші перспективи розвитку та можливість перекваліфікуватися.
  • Кар’єрний розвиток у QA залежить від вашої наполегливості, постійного навчання і готовності брати на себе відповідальність.
  • Тут з’являється своя рутина — контроль результатів цих автотестів, їх коригування за потреби, налаштування та підтримка середовища виконання тестів.
  • Я б радив також подивитися поглиблені курси по кожній із вивчених технологій і переглянути щось із того, що вказують у вакансіях для QA, але чого немає у ваших компетенціях.
  • Почав вчити, ходити на курси англійської і готуватися до співбесід.

Senior — це фахівець, який сам враховує всі ризики, відповідає за свої факапи й може їх заменеджити, звести до мінімуму». Роботу тестувальника видно, коли вона виконана погано та є критичні баги на продакшені. Іншими словами, розробник може сказати „дивись, я зробив цей продукт“. QA так сказати не може, адже він продукт не робив, а тільки тестував».

Средняя зарплата в РФ

Яку мову програмування обрати тестувальнику-автоматизатору? У першій ви можете вказати назву професії та обрати місто (Київ, Львів, Харків, Запоріжжя, Дніпро). У розширеному варіанті також доступна фільтрація за напрямом діяльності, рівнем вимог, типом зайнятості. Крім того, ви можете вибрати фірму із списку, якщо зацікавлені qa automation java вакансії знайти посаду QA engineer у конкретній компанії. А ще тестувати продукт можна «вручну» (manual), а також за допомогою коду (automation). Відповідно до цього розрізняють два види QA-інженерів.

👾 Manual, Automation, General — у чому різниця

Важливо не лише прийти до розробників та сказати їм, що щось потрібно переробити. Цей фахівець має досвід і в мануальному, і в автоматизованому тестуванні. Тестувальник розробляє стратегії тестування, плани та набір тест-кейсів для виконання різноманітних тестів. Тест-кейси створюють для кожного завдання, яке можливо протестувати.

  • Він, як і Manual QA, повинен знати теорію тестування.
  • Іноді люди переходять від однієї спеціальності до іншої.
  • Вона враховує всю активність, потрібну, щоб зробити це завдання.
  • «Зараз часто компанії об’єднують всі ці обов’язки в одному фахівці — QA.
  • Крім того, ви можете вибрати фірму із списку, якщо зацікавлені знайти посаду QA engineer у конкретній компанії.
  • Приміром, там була команда мануальників, які написали тест-кейси.

— Я закінчив політехнічний інститут за спеціальністю радіотехніка. До ІТ працював у сфері телекомунікацій, в продажах та інженером-конструктором. Бажання покращити фінансове становище стимулювало мене змінити сферу діяльності.

  • «На старті важливе володіння тулзами для тестування API (Postman та SoapUI), Charles та/або Fiddler.
  • — Завдання QA Automation Engineer залежать від проєкту, на якому ти працюєш.
  • Найбільша частка фахівців — рівня Middle, тобто мають досвід роботи 3-5 років та медіанну зарплату $2000.
  • Є певний список обов’язків, які виконує QA automation engineer.
  • Бажання покращити фінансове становище стимулювало мене змінити сферу діяльності.

А ще пріоритезувати завдання, розуміти вплив на бізнес того чи іншого дефекту. Обовʼязок QA — думати як бізнес, жити бізнесом під час роботи, думати про оптимізацію, покращення. QA витрачає час зараз, щоб зекономити його в майбутньому». Існує безліч поглядів на те, які навички потрібні QA Engineer, але часто вони формуються на основі власного досвіду в певній компанії та сфері бізнесу.

Способи та поради щодо відновлення видалених повідомлень у Whatsapp

професія QA Automation Engineer

Не варто нехтувати й літературою, особливо зарубіжною. Кожен охочий може навіть безплатно отримати доступ до цінних джерел інформації та Product manager це освоїти професію QA-Engineer. Але чим більше знаєш — тим більш цікави тести можна задизайнити.

QA automation engineer: профиль и особенности профессии

На Python можна зробити багато речей простіше, ніж на Java, наприклад. Крім того, важливі також компетенції зі сфери бізнес-аналізу та управління проєктами. Наприклад, розуміння, що таке ризики та як ними керувати (є навіть risk-based підхід до тестування), цикл розробки та ролі в ньому тощо. Звісно автоматизатору не потрібно розбиратися в коді на рівні розробника, але завжди добре, якщо людина різнобічно розвинена. Проте навіть просте знання бази та наявність здорового глузду вже дозволить стати досить успішним автоматизатором. Як я й казала, для входу в професію необхідні певні hard skills.

Trả lời

Email của bạn sẽ không được hiển thị công khai. Các trường bắt buộc được đánh dấu *